Transaction 058717047577602e3495ec0f80a44e9591a529d7f5eb3bee8d6ed52dd593eb26

2 Input
2 Outputs
  • 058717047577602e3495ec0f80a44e9591a529d7f5eb3bee8d6ed52dd593eb26:0
  • value  2010984
    address  3Cud5X5s1HKjJ2QTqYzBrqegf5Ts5X8KJM
  • 058717047577602e3495ec0f80a44e9591a529d7f5eb3bee8d6ed52dd593eb26:1
  • value  8610982
    address  3PwYo551AXBTPsNpTrGeuTJn2FBFbpGrLs